You are viewing: Canada Medical Device Manufacturing Equipment (by Production) Market analysis

The Canada Medical Device Manufacturing Equipment (by Production) Market was valued at $220.1 Million in 2025 and projected to reach to $285.4 Million by 2030, representing a compound annual growth rate of 5.3%. Canada's medical device manufacturing equipment market is positioned for sustained growth through 2030, driven by the country's commitment to strengthening domestic healthcare manufacturing capabilities.

    Market Definition

    Medical device manufacturing equipment (by production) refers to the specialized machinery, systems, and technologies used by medical device manufacturers to design, process, assemble, test, package, and sterilize medical devices. This includes equipment for material processing (cutting, welding, molding, coating, additive manufacturing), assembly & automation systems (robotics, inspection, testing), and cleanroom & packaging solutions (sterilization, sealing, environmental control).
